Goatman said:The weekend of Nov 7-9 is Panamint Valley Days. There are many scenic easy runs and scenic moderate runs there, plus you don't have to cook because the Rough Run Cafe is always set up for the event. There is a scenic sunset run on Friday evening for those who can get there by 6 pm.
I'll be there and am doing trial crew on Saturday on the Defense Mine run. The trail goes to the mine which is very cool to explore. You can go up through ladders to three levels and come out way up the hill from the entrance....one of the more interesting mines to explore.
